Powdered Asafoetida

Powdered asafoetida, derived from the resin of Ferula assa-foetida, is a pungent spice commonly used in Indian cuisine. It is known for its unique flavor and potential health benefits.

Asafoetida has been shown to have antimicrobial properties, which may help in preventing infections.
It is traditionally used to aid digestion and reduce bloating, making it beneficial for gastrointestinal health.

Apple

Apples are a popular fruit known for their crisp texture and sweet-tart flavor. They are rich in dietary fiber, vitamins, and antioxidants, making them a nutritious choice for a healthy diet.

Apples are high in dietary fiber, which aids in digestion and helps maintain a healthy gut.
Rich in antioxidants, apples may help reduce the risk of chronic diseases such as heart disease and diabetes.
